About Pontus Wärnestål

Pontus Wärnestål (he/him) is an award-winning Service Designer and Human-Computer Interaction researcher, with 20+ years of work and research experience in User Experience, Service Design, and Human-Centered AI. He is the author of 40+ scientific papers and books, including "Designing AI-Powered Services" which is used by several design and HCI education programs. Pontus currently serves as Deputy Professor at Halmstad University in Sweden.

Beyond the Hype: Designing AI-Powered Services that Work

As AI transitions from hype to a core component of service and UX design, there’s an urgent need for designers to treat AI as a new material for innovation, crafting experiences that not only captivate end-users but also enhance internal efficiency in the organization.
